数据库管理系统是什么6
-
数据库管理系统(DBMS)是一种软件工具,用于管理和组织数据库的创建、维护和操作。它允许用户通过使用结构化查询语言(SQL)来访问和操作数据库中的数据。以下是关于数据库管理系统的六个重要点:
-
数据库管理系统提供数据组织和存储的功能。它可以创建和管理数据库表、索引和视图,以及定义数据之间的关系。通过使用DBMS,用户可以轻松地组织和存储大量的数据,并且可以根据需要对其进行扩展和修改。
-
DBMS提供数据访问和查询的功能。用户可以使用SQL语言来执行各种查询操作,例如选择特定的数据行、插入新数据、更新现有数据或删除数据。DBMS还提供了高级查询功能,如连接多个表、排序数据和聚合计算。
-
数据库管理系统具有数据安全性和完整性的功能。它可以通过用户身份验证、权限管理和事务控制来保护数据库中的数据免受未经授权的访问和修改。DBMS还可以实施一致性和数据完整性规则,以确保数据的一致性和准确性。
-
DBMS提供了数据备份和恢复的功能。它可以定期备份数据库,并在发生故障或数据丢失时恢复数据。通过使用DBMS的备份和恢复功能,用户可以确保数据库的可靠性和可用性。
-
数据库管理系统支持并发控制和并行处理。它可以处理多个用户同时对数据库进行访问和操作的情况,而不会导致数据冲突和不一致。DBMS使用并发控制技术来管理并发访问,以确保数据的一致性和完整性。
-
DBMS提供了性能优化和调优的功能。它可以通过索引、查询优化和存储优化等技术来提高数据库的性能和效率。通过使用DBMS的性能优化功能,用户可以提高数据访问和处理的速度,从而提高应用程序的性能和响应时间。
总而言之,数据库管理系统是一种关键的软件工具,它提供了数据组织、存储、访问和操作的功能,并确保数据的安全性、完整性和可靠性。它还支持并发控制、性能优化和调优,以提高数据库的性能和效率。
1年前 -
-
数据库管理系统(Database Management System,简称DBMS)是一种用于管理和组织数据的软件系统。它提供了一种结构化的方式来存储、管理和操作数据,使得数据可以高效地被访问和使用。
-
数据库管理系统的定义:数据库管理系统是一种软件系统,用于管理和组织数据,提供数据的高效存储和访问。
-
数据库管理系统的功能:数据库管理系统具备以下功能:
- 数据定义功能:定义和描述数据的结构和属性,包括创建、修改和删除数据库对象,如表、视图、索引等。
- 数据操作功能:提供数据的增删改查操作,包括插入、更新、删除和查询数据。
- 数据控制功能:实现对数据的安全性和完整性控制,包括权限管理、事务管理和并发控制。
- 数据库维护功能:提供数据库的备份、恢复和优化等维护操作,确保数据库的稳定性和性能。
-
数据库管理系统的特点:
- 数据共享:多个用户可以同时访问和共享数据库中的数据,实现数据的共享和协作。
- 数据独立性:数据库管理系统将数据与应用程序分离,实现数据与应用的独立性,提高了系统的灵活性和可维护性。
- 数据一致性:数据库管理系统通过事务管理和并发控制等机制,保证数据的一致性和完整性。
- 数据安全性:数据库管理系统提供了权限管理和安全控制等机制,保护数据的安全性和隐私性。
-
数据库管理系统的分类:
- 层次数据库管理系统(Hierarchical DBMS):数据以层次结构组织,每个父节点可以有多个子节点。
- 网状数据库管理系统(Network DBMS):数据以网状结构组织,每个节点可以有多个父节点和子节点。
- 关系数据库管理系统(Relational DBMS):数据以表格形式组织,通过关系运算实现数据的查询和操作。
- 对象数据库管理系统(Object DBMS):数据以对象的形式组织,支持面向对象的数据模型和操作。
-
数据库管理系统的应用领域:数据库管理系统广泛应用于各个领域,包括企业管理、金融、电子商务、医疗健康、物流管理等。它为这些领域提供了高效的数据管理和处理能力,支持业务的快速发展和决策的准确性。
总结:数据库管理系统是一种用于管理和组织数据的软件系统,具备数据定义、数据操作、数据控制和数据库维护等功能。它具有数据共享、数据独立性、数据一致性和数据安全性等特点,广泛应用于各个领域。
1年前 -
-
数据库管理系统(Database Management System,简称DBMS)是一种用于管理和组织数据库的软件系统。它提供了一种方便和有效的方式来存储、访问和处理数据。数据库管理系统允许用户定义、创建、修改和删除数据库中的数据,同时还提供了一些高级功能,如数据备份、数据恢复、数据安全和数据一致性控制等。
数据库管理系统的主要目标是提供一个可靠、高效、安全和易于使用的数据管理环境。它通过使用数据模型、数据结构和操作语言来实现这些目标。数据库管理系统通常由以下几个组件组成:
-
数据模型:数据模型是描述数据库中数据组织和关系的方式。常见的数据模型包括层次模型、网络模型、关系模型和面向对象模型等。
-
数据库结构:数据库结构定义了数据库中数据的逻辑和物理结构。它包括表、字段、索引、约束等对象。
-
数据操作语言:数据操作语言(Data Manipulation Language,简称DML)用于查询、插入、更新和删除数据库中的数据。常见的DML语言包括SQL(Structured Query Language)。
-
数据定义语言:数据定义语言(Data Definition Language,简称DDL)用于创建、修改和删除数据库的结构。DDL语言用于定义表、字段、索引、视图等数据库对象。
-
数据库管理工具:数据库管理系统通常提供一些管理工具,用于管理和监控数据库的运行。这些工具可以用于备份和恢复数据、优化数据库性能、监视数据库活动等。
-
数据安全和一致性控制:数据库管理系统提供了一些机制来保护数据的安全性和保持数据的一致性。这些机制包括用户权限管理、事务处理、并发控制等。
数据库管理系统的操作流程通常包括以下几个步骤:
-
数据库设计:在开始使用数据库管理系统之前,需要进行数据库设计。数据库设计包括确定数据模型、定义表结构、选择字段类型、建立关系等。
-
数据库创建:根据数据库设计的结果,使用数据库管理系统创建数据库。在创建数据库时,需要指定数据库的名称、存储路径、字符集等参数。
-
表创建:在数据库中创建表,定义表的结构和字段。在创建表时,需要指定表的名称、字段名称、字段类型、约束等信息。
-
数据操作:使用数据操作语言(如SQL)对数据库进行查询、插入、更新和删除操作。可以通过编写SQL语句或使用数据库管理工具进行数据操作。
-
数据备份和恢复:定期进行数据备份,以防止数据丢失。在发生数据丢失或损坏的情况下,可以使用备份文件进行数据恢复。
-
数据安全和一致性控制:设置用户权限,限制用户对数据库的访问和操作。使用事务处理和并发控制机制来保持数据的一致性和完整性。
总之,数据库管理系统是一种用于管理和组织数据库的软件系统,它提供了一种方便和有效的方式来存储、访问和处理数据。通过定义数据模型、数据结构和操作语言,以及提供数据安全和一致性控制机制,数据库管理系统可以实现数据的有效管理和保护。
1年前 -